Product Introduction
The DS3800HEDB is the high-density 24V DC output board, offering 32 channels in a single Mark V slot—twice the density of the 16-channel boards we’ve covered. This board uses MOSFET outputs with built-in flyback diodes, making it ideal for driving 24V DC solenoids, relays, and indicator lamps in applications where cabinet space is at a premium. The 32-channel capacity reduces the number of I/O modules needed, freeing up rack slots for other functions. The board’s 0.5A per channel rating is suitable for most 24V DC field devices, though you’ll need to manage the total current if driving multiple loads.
We’ve used the HEDB in skid-mounted turbine control packages where rack space was limited—the 32-channel density allowed us to drive 64 outputs with just two boards. The MOSFET outputs switch in about 1ms, and the built-in flyback diodes protect against inductive kickback from solenoids. The status LEDs show the output state, powered from the 5V logic rail. The board’s backplane current draw is 1.2A, which is moderate for a 32-channel board. The HEDB is a solid choice for high-density 24V DC output applications.
Key Technical Specifications
| Parameter | Value / Range |
|---|---|
| Discrete Output Channels | 32 (MOSFET outputs) |
| Output Voltage Range | 18-30V DC |
| Output Current (Continuous) | 0.5A per channel (resistive) |
| Output Current (Inductive) | 0.25A per channel (with flyback diode) |
| Total Aggregate Current | 8A (all channels combined) |
| On-Resistance | < 0.2Ω |
| Switching Time | 1ms (typical) |
| Flyback Protection | Built-in diodes per channel |
| Isolation Voltage | 2500V AC (field-to-logic) |
| Logic Supply Voltage | 5 VDC (from backplane) |
| Backplane Current Draw (5V) | 1.2A (max) |
| Channel Status Indicators | Green LEDs per channel |
| Operating Temperature | 0°C to 55°C (derate above 45°C) |
| Storage Temperature | -40°C to 85°C |
| Terminal Block Type | Screw-clamp, pitch 5.08mm (suffix-dependent) |
Compatible Replacement Models
| Model | Compatibility Class | Notes & Caveats |
|---|---|---|
| DS3800HEDB (same revision) | ✅ Drop-in Replacement | Exact match on all hardware and firmware. No adjustments needed. |
| DS3800HEDB (different suffix) | ⚠️ Software Compatible | Suffix variations affect termination only. Electronics identical. Verify connector pitch matches your harness. |
| DS3800HECA | ⚠️ Software Compatible | Similar high-density 24V DC output board with different backplane addressing. Check compatibility before swapping. |
| DS3800HCIC (any suffix) | ⚠️ Software Compatible | 16-channel 24V DC output board—not high-density. The HEDB is a higher-density alternative. |
| DS3800HDPA (any suffix) | ❌ Hardware Incompatible | 125V DC output board. The HEDB is for 24V DC loads. |
Frequently Asked Questions (FAQ)
Q: What’s the total aggregate current capacity of the HEDB?
A: The HEDB has a total aggregate current limit of 8A across all 32 channels. Each channel is rated at 0.5A continuous, so the theoretical maximum is 16A—but the board is limited to 8A total. This means you can’t run all 32 channels at 0.5A simultaneously. If you have 32 channels at 0.25A each, that’s 8A total, which is fine. If you need more current, you’ll need to distribute loads across multiple boards.
Q: Can I drive a 24V DC solenoid with the HEDB?
A: Yes, as long as the solenoid’s current is under 0.5A (resistive) or 0.25A (inductive) per channel. The board’s flyback diode will protect the MOSFET from inductive kickback. If your solenoid draws more than 0.25A, consider using an external contactor or a higher-current output board. The HEDB is designed for low-current 24V DC loads, not heavy solenoids.
Q: The HEDB has 32 channels. Does it use a different backplane connector than the 16-channel boards?
A: Yes. The HEDB uses a higher-density backplane connector to accommodate 32 channels. While the physical footprint is the same as other Mark V boards, the connector has more pins. You cannot plug a 32-channel board into a slot that was wired for a 16-channel board without re-terminating the harness. The pin assignments are different. Always verify the backplane wiring before installing an HEDB.
Q: The status LEDs are powered from the 5V logic rail. What happens if the field supply is off?
A: The LEDs will still show the output state as commanded by the controller, even if the field supply is off. This can be misleading during troubleshooting. Always verify the field supply voltage at the load terminals with a multimeter. The LED indicates the logic state, not the actual presence of field power. We’ve seen this confusion on field startups.
Q: How do I manage the total aggregate current of the HEDB?
A: The 8A total limit is a hard limit—exceeding it can damage the board’s internal power distribution. To stay within the limit, calculate the total current for all active channels. For example, if you have 24 channels at 0.25A each, that’s 6A total, which is fine. If you have 20 channels at 0.5A each, that’s 10A total—you’ll need to reduce the load or use a second board. The board’s firmware does not have per-channel current limiting; it’s up to you to manage the total current.
Q: Can I use the HEDB with a 12V DC supply?
A: No. The HEDB is designed for 18-30V DC. At 12V, the MOSFETs may not fully turn on, resulting in higher on-resistance and overheating. If you have 12V DC loads, you’ll need a different board or an external voltage regulator. The HEDB is specifically for 24V DC applications.
Q: Does the HEDB have conformal coating?
A: Not by default. The HEDB’s suffix typically indicates termination type, not coating. If you need conformal coating for harsh environments, look for a suffix with a “G” (e.g., DS3800HEDB1G1G). The standard HEDB is suitable for indoor environments. If your plant has high humidity or corrosive conditions, consider a coated variant.
